How did Osama bin Laden really die?
From the evidence, the case could be made that if President Barack Obama had terrorist Osama bin Laden killed in May 2011 at the latter's Abbottabad compound in Pakistan, Obama would have had to bring him back from the dead to do so.

On December 26, 2001, the Egyptian newspaper a-l Wafd posted a death announcement for bin Laden, citing as its source "a prominent official in the Afghan Taleban movement."  According to the source, bin Laden had received a formal Islamic burial ten days prior in Tora Bora.

On July 30, 2002, CNN headlined an article "Sources: No bodyguards, no bin Laden."  Apparently, several members of bin Laden's security team had been captured and shipped to Guantanamo.  Reported CNN, "Some high-level U.S. officials are already convinced by such evidence that bin Laden, who has not been seen or heard from in months, is dead."

On October 7, 2002, CNN ran a speculative article citing Afghan president Hamid Karzai, headlined "Karzai: bin Laden 'probably' dead."  On May 10, 2003, the U.K.'s Independent headlined an article, "Bin Laden died from wounds suffered in Tora Bora air raid, says Arab expert."  The expert in question traced his death to December 2001, the same month as the notice in the Egyptian paper.

Bin Laden had been in poor health for several years.  In March 2000, Asia Week described him as having "a kidney infection that is propagating itself to the liver and requires specialized treatment."  Additionally, a mobile dialysis machine had been delivered to his hideout in Kandahar in the first half of 2000.  Examining a video from December 2001, CNN medical correspondent Dr. Sanjay Gupta argued that bin Laden was likely suffering from "chronic kidney failure, renal failure."
